OPS: Verteiltes Szenario 

 

Jede ORACLE-Instanz hat ein eigenes lokales Archivierungsverzeichnis. Dieses Verzeichnis sollte nicht auf einer gemounteten Platte liegen.

BRARCHIVE wird lokal auf den Rechnern aller ORACLE-Instanzen gestartet.

In diesem Fall arbeitet BRARCHIVE ähnlich wie unter einer Konfiguration ohne Parallel Server Option. BRARCHIVE sichert jeweils die Offline-Redo-Log-Dateien der lokalen Instanz. BRARCHIVE kann diese anhand der Thread-Nummer ( init<DBSID>.ora -Parmeter thread ), die jeder lokalen Instanz zugeordnet ist, ermitteln.

Falls im lokalen Archivierungsverzeichnis Offline-Redo-Log-Dateien anderer Instanzen anfallen, archiviert BRARCHIVE diese ebenfalls.

Jede ORACLE-Instanz hat eine eigene durch BRARCHIVE gesteuerte Datenträger-Verwaltung. Auf jedem Sicherungsband sind die Offline-Redo-Log-Dateien gesichert, die in dem lokalen Archivierungsverzeichnis der entsprechenden Instanz gefunden wurden (in Ausnahmefällen kann es sich dabei um Offline-Redo-Log-Dateien verschiedener Instanzen handeln). Die Zuordnung der Offline-Redo-Log-Dateien zu den einzelnen Instanzen ist aus den Dateinamen ersichtlich. Die Namenskonventionen werden durch die init<DBSID>.ora -Parameter log_archive_dest und log_archive_format vorgegeben.

log_archive_dest = /oracle/C11/saparch/C11arch

log_archive_format = %t_%s.dbf

%t - Threadnummer (zur Identifizierung der Instanz)

%s - Log-Sequenznummer

Der ORACLE-Platzhalter @ (für ORACLE_SID) darf im Namen einer Offline-Redo-Log-Datei nicht erscheinen, also auch weder in log_archive_dest noch in log_archive_format .

Die Archivierung der Offline-Redo-Log-Dateien kann entweder auf lokalen Bandstationen (an dem jeweiligen Rechner der Instanz angeschlossen, backup_dev_type = tape ) oder auf Bandstationen, die an dem Rechner der DDB-Instanz angeschlossen sind ( backup_dev_type = pipe ), durchgeführt werden.

Vorteile

Nachteile

 

Der Einsatz von BRARCHIVE in der Form des verteilten Szenarios kann dann sinnvoll sein, wenn auf jeder ORACLE-Instanz sehr viele Offline-Redo-Log-Dateien anfallen, die jeweils einen Datenträger (Band) zum großen Teil füllen würden.

Weitere Bemerkungen

Die Offline-Redo-Log-Dateien werden benötigt, wenn die Datenbank wiederhergestellt werden muß. Recovery-Maßnahmen sollten nur von einem erfahrenen Administrator durchgeführt werden, der das OPS-spezifische Verhalten des Datenbanksystems in diesem Fall kennt.

Wenn die Offline-Redo-Log-Dateien zurückgeladen werden sollen, ist auf folgendes zu achten:

Die benötigten Offline-Redo-Log-Dateien müssen für jede Instanz separat zurückgeladen werden (mittels SAPDBA oder einem BRRESTORE-Aufruf). Zielverzeichnis ist dabei für die Offline-Redo-Log-Dateien aller Instanzen das Archivierungsverzeichnis der Instanz, von der aus das Recovery des Datenbanksystems gestartet werden soll. Starten Sie dann das Recovery (Informationen dazu finden Sie in der ORACLE-Dokumentation).